What is the Retirement Income Term Allocated Pension Change Form?
The Retirement Income Term Allocated Pension Change Form is a crucial document designed for members to update essential financial institution details, modify pension payment frequencies, and adjust payment amounts. The primary function of this form is to facilitate smooth transitions in pension arrangements, ensuring users can manage their retirement income effectively. Key terms such as "allocated pension" define the type of retirement income this form addresses, specifically within Western Australia.

Field-by-Field Instructions for Completing the Retirement Income Term Allocated Pension Change Form
Understanding each field in the form is essential for accurate completion. Below are instructions for various fields:
-
Financial Institution: Enter the name of your bank or financial provider.
-
BSB Number: Provide the unique six-digit number identifying your bank branch.
-
Account Number: Input your account number accurately.
-
Select Payment Amount: Choose your preferred pension amount and frequency.
